首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
js
订阅
dzcc
更多收藏集
微信扫码分享
微信
新浪微博
QQ
11篇文章 · 0订阅
工作中遇到的50个JavaScript的基础知识点
本文已参与「掘力星计划」,赢取创作大礼包,挑战创作激励金。 前言 大家好,我是林三心,基础是进阶的前提,今天给大家分享一下,我这一年来工作中遇到的50个「基础知识点」,我这一年来就有记录知识点的习惯哈
浅拷贝与深拷贝
浅拷贝是创建一个新对象,这个对象有着原始对象属性值的一份精确拷贝。如果属性是基本类型,拷贝的就是基本类型的值,如果属性是引用类型,拷贝的就是内存地址 ,所以如果其中一个对象改变了这个地址,就会影响到另一个对象。 深拷贝是将一个对象从内存中完整的拷贝一份出来,从堆内存中开辟一个新…
JS原型链与继承别再被问倒了
我面试过很多同学,其中能把原型继承讲明白的寥寥无几,能把new操作符讲明白的就更少了。希望这篇文章能够解决你的疑惑,带你面试飞起来。 继承是OO语言中的一个最为人津津乐道的概念.许多OO语言都支持两种继承方式: 接口继承 和 实现继承 .接口继承只继承方法签名,而实现继承则继承…
Vue+Element前端导入导出Excel(附 Demo)
由前台导入Excel表格,获取批量数据。 根据一个数组导出Excel表格。 fileTemp这里定义了一下变量,指向最新上传的附件,起始定义为null。 这里发现控件file.raw是我们要用的File类型。 arr就是我们要的结果,是一个数组。每一个值是个对象,包含了code…
用了这个设计模式,我优化了50%表单校验代码
假设我们正在编写一个注册页面,在点击注册按钮之时,有一些校验逻辑。我们通常会使用一些 if 语句来覆盖所有规则,但这样使得代码臃肿且无法复用。能否使用一种设计模式来解决上述问题呢?
面试官:说说 var、let、const 的区别
关于 var、let 和 const 三个关键字的区别,是一个老生常谈的问题,也是经典的面试题。本篇文章将全面讲解三者的特性,以及它们之间的区别,由浅入深让你彻底搞懂这个知识点。
2025年,在学一遍JS原型、原型链
全面了解原型、原型链。原型和继承是js中非常重要的两大概念。深入了解原型,也是是学好继承的前提。 本文将从 普通对象、引用类型对象、内置对象三个方向全面了解原型和原型链。
8个JS的reduce使用实例,和reduce的骚操作
reduce方法是JavaScript中一个比较强大的方法,可能在平时开发中,有人根本没用过,通过下面的8个例子,学会reduce的用法以及它的常用场景。 reduce方法是一个数组的迭代方法,和ma
由浅入深,66条JavaScript面试知识点
我只想面个CV工程师,面试官偏偏让我挑战造火箭工程师,加上今年这个情况更是前后两男,但再难苟且的生活还要继续,饭碗还是要继续找的。在最近的面试中我一直在总结,每次面试回来也都会复盘,下面是我这几天遇到的面试知识点。但今天主题是标题所写的66条JavaScript知识点,由浅入深…
使用这11个代码,可以大大地简化我们的代码。
在这篇文章中,我将与你分享一些关于JS的技巧,可以提高你的JS技能。 1.避免 if 过长 如果判断值满足多个条件,我们可能会这么写: 像这样如果有多个条件,if 条件就会很我,可读性降低,我们可以这